About the Opportunity

As the Manager of Business Processes& Projects, you will lead the identification, prioritisation and implementation of projects and improvement activities across the Motoring & Mobility division, including quantifying business benefit realisation from these initiatives.

You will be responsible for developing and managing plans and project budgets, including program inter-dependencies, monitoring and driving deliverables across project team members, external partners and other business units.

Key responsibilities of the role:

  • Lead the identification, prioritisation and implementation of improvement activities utilising specified change and continuous improvement frameworks.
  • Interpreting business needs and translating these into operational requirements.
  • Leading and coordinating the review and reporting of initiative progress to management and stakeholders and ensure ongoing alignment with strategic objectives.
  • Taking accountability, managing and delivering from inception to delivery and completion.
  • Develop, improve and manage modelling and process frameworks which will allow comprehensive analysis and monitoring to be conducted.
  • Provide expert advice to stakeholders and leaders and provide recommendations on operational improvements.
  • Provide expert support through training and development activities within the team to increase capability and competence.
  • Lead and establish effective relationships with key internal and external stakeholders in a manner that contributes to the RACV M&M portfolio achieving their goals.
  • Act as a coach and mentor to peers within the Motoring products and projects team

What you’ll need to be successful

  • Good knowledge and handling of project management methodology and techniques
  • Ability to build credibility, trust and rapport with stakeholders at all levels, internal and external to the organisation
  • Ability to understand complex business problems with analytical and technical mindset
  • 4+years’ experience in project, stakeholder and change management methodologies to successfully deliver sustainable improvement outcomes
  • Tertiary qualifications in commerce, business, IT or related field desirable
  • 4+years’ experience in a medium to large organisation in related roles analysing Business Processes, identifying and implementing technology-based and transaction-based customer service
  • Experienced in facilitating workshops to engage cross-functional groups to understand complex business problems and agree long term solutions
  • Experience using Confluence & Jira
  • Commitment to engender initiative, innovation and accountability to establish and develop teams to achieve results under changing conditions.
  • Demonstrated ability to successfully manage complex projects from concept to completion, to agreed deliverables for a successful outcome 
  • Demonstrated experience in a project environment, including scheduling, reporting, coaching and supporting others in the use of project management principles and processes
